I can't remember when my first local EB opened... might have been '97 or '98... but back then it was a bigger deal. I don't think back then it was as common for retailers to clear out inventory in the fashion they do these days... so back then they offered a better selection and it was about the only place where you could find a non-Greatest Hits title for $20 on occasion.

These days, I think Amazon is eating their lunch a bit, but with the way retail is going in general, I think it's a pretty important brick-and-mortar presence, even with their shift to more pop culture junk. There's Walmart, there's Best Buy and there's...? Shoppers? (Out west, London Drugs)

And Best Buy's in-store gaming selection seems pretty anemic these days. I liked Superstore as a game retailer, but I think they're totally done. I haven't seen anything recent coming to any of the locations I go to. Are we getting close to a Walmart/EB industry?
